This report uses UNEP’s methodology for Integrated Environmental Assessment (IEA), known as GEO methodology that promotes a participatory and multidisciplinary approach to include the views and inputs of experts and practitioners, in identifying the most relevant environmental challenges and options for action. Indeed, the GEO Belize report was developed through the participation of experts from the academia, NGO´s and inputs from Ministries and their technical bodies whose contributions have converged into a shared view of the main environmental challenges faced by the country.
